Address 1376.77123752 DOGE

DRWVXzh9QMjKNvMopJBgntyMf192Uhe1JS

Confirmed

Total Received1376.77123752 DOGE
Total Sent0 DOGE
Final Balance1376.77123752 DOGE
No. Transactions1

Transactions